PBA World Series of Bowling Returns to Detroit Area

The Professional Bowlers Association will return to Allen Park, Michigan, near Detroit for the 10th anniversary of the World Series of Bowling in March 2019. Thunderbowl Lanes, which hosted the first edition of the event in 2009, will once again host. Detroit to Host Final Game of USA Hockey and Hockey Canada Series

USA Hockey and Hockey Canada have announced that the women’s national teams from the United States and Canada will compete in a three-game series February 12–17, 2019. North Texas to Host Mexican National Soccer Team Through 2022

A new partnership between the National Football League’s Dallas Cowboys, Federación Mexicana de Fútbol (FMF), Major League Soccer’s FC Dallas and the Dallas Sports Commission will bring the Mexican National Team U.S. Tour to North Texas through 2022. Esports Stadium Opens in Arlington, Texas

Esports Stadium Arlington has opened at the Arlington Convention Center in the North Texas city, marking the launch of what will be the largest gaming and esports event complex in North America. Tuscaloosa to Host 2020–2021 USA Triathlon Duathlon National Championships

Tuscaloosa, Alabama, has been selected to host the 2020–2021 USA Triathlon Duathlon National Championships, which will feature the nation’s best run-bike-run athletes as they compete for national titles in three events.
